Ceiling Fan Wiring in Olathe, KS
Ceiling fan wiring services involve installing, repairing, or upgrading the electrical connections necessary for ceiling fans to operate safely and efficiently. This can include initial installations in new construction or renovations, as well as troubleshooting and fixing existing wiring issues that may cause flickering, noise, or non-functioning fans. Projects often cover connecting fans to existing electrical circuits, ensuring proper grounding, and integrating controls such as switches, remotes, or dimmers to enhance convenience and functionality.
Homeowners typically seek ceiling fan wiring services to improve comfort, energy efficiency, and room aesthetics. Before requesting service, property owners should understand the type of wiring currently in place, whether the electrical system can support additional fixtures, and if any modifications are needed for control options. Clarifying these details helps ensure the installation or repair process aligns with the specific electrical setup of the property.

Ceiling Fan Wiring Questions
What is involved in ceiling fan wiring? Proper wiring connects the fan's motor, switches, and power source to ensure safe and reliable operation.
Can existing wiring support a new ceiling fan? An inspection can determine if the current wiring meets the electrical requirements for a ceiling fan installation.
Is it necessary to turn off power before wiring a ceiling fan? Yes, shutting off the power at the circuit breaker is essential to safely work on ceiling fan wiring.
What type of wiring is typically used for ceiling fans? Standard household electrical wiring, usually 14 or 12-gauge, is used depending on the fan's power needs.
